unit 4 - statistics. two dice are tossed. find the probability of getting the sum of the dice equal to 9. (hint: draw a tree - diagram of the possibilities of two tosses of a die, and then find the sum of the numbers on each branch.) the probability of getting a sum of 9 is (type a whole number or a simplified fraction.)

Explanation:

Step1: Find total number of outcomes

When two dice are tossed, each die has 6 possible outcomes. So the total number of outcomes is \(6\times6 = 36\) according to the multiplication - principle.

Step2: Find number of favorable outcomes

The pairs of numbers on the two dice that sum to 9 are \((3,6)\), \((4,5)\), \((5,4)\), \((6,3)\). So there are 4 favorable outcomes.

Step3: Calculate probability

The probability \(P\) of an event is given by the formula \(P=\frac{\text{Number of favorable outcomes}}{\text{Total number of outcomes}}\). So \(P = \frac{4}{36}=\frac{1}{9}\).

Answer:

\(\frac{1}{9}\)
